Rechargeable Batteries Irrespective of Power Capability

Two of the rechargeable batteries, namely the Pb-add and Ni-Cd, have impressively long histories. The Pb-acid batteries were first manufactured as early as 1860, whereas the Ni-Cd batteries were first manufactured around 1910. The other rechargeable batteries such as zinc-manganese dioxide (Zn-MnOj), Ni-MH, and Li are relatively young, but they are widely deployed in portable devices and sensors. The Li and Ni-MH batteries are best suited for portable electronic components, where rehability, longevity, and uninterrupted power sources are the principal requirements. Furthermore, these values are for the commercially available rechargeable batteries, which were designed, developed, and tested before 2000. Obviously, one will find further improvement in the characteristics and performance capabilities of rechargeable batteries because of rapid advances of the Ni-MH and Li batteries designed and developed after 2005. One will notice significant performance improvement, particularly in the case of Li batteries, which come in four distinct categories Li (monopolar), Li (bipolar), Li (polymer), and Li (using polymeric electrolyte). [Pg.15]
